Xbox One S 1TB All-Digital Edition Console (Disc-free Gaming) - $199

Bundle includes:

1TB Xbox One S All-Digital Edition Console (Disc-free Gaming), wireless controller, a 1-Month Xbox Live Gold subscription, and download codes for Anthem, Minecraft, Forza Horizon 3, and Sea of Thieves. (Sea of Thieves requires an Xbox Live Gold subscription, sold separately.)


Xbox One S Console +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order Deluxe Edition - $279

        the only advantages of digital are it saves u changing discs, can gave access to your library when u travel and u can have 2. players playing your digital titles at a time if you have another xbox

        • +1

          I primarily buy digital for the 2 players at once. I only ever buy on special which is usually cheaper or same price as the hard copy.

          2x kids with a console each makes it the cheapest way. Still like the security of a disc console. Watching movies, ability for disc games if you can grab bargains etc.
